What are the responsibilities and job description for the Dielectric Testing Technician position at T and E Flow Services?
Key Responsibilities:
- Perform dielectric testing on rubber goods, including gloves, sleeves, blankets, and line hose, following industry standards (e.g., ASTM, OSHA).
- Inspect, clean, and prepare equipment for testing and certification.
- Accurately document test results, maintain detailed records, and generate compliance reports.
- Calibrate and maintain testing equipment to ensure accurate measurements.
- Follow strict safety protocols and maintain a clean, organized lab environment.
- Collaborate with team members and other departments to ensure timely processing of customer orders.
- Assist with inventory management and equipment tracking.
